	<xsd:simpleType name="NCTMmathProcessStandardsType">
		<xsd:annotation>
			<xsd:documentation>
				***************************************  NCTMmathProcessStandardsType  ***************************************
				Lists the values that will appear in the metadata record
			</xsd:documentation>
		</xsd:annotation>
		<xsd:restriction base="xsd:string">
			<xsd:enumeration value="NCTM:Problem Solving:Build new mathematical knowledge through problem solving"/>
			<xsd:enumeration value="NCTM:Problem Solving:Solve problems that arise in mathematics and in other contexts"/>
			<xsd:enumeration value="NCTM:Problem Solving:Apply and adapt a variety of appropriate strategies to solve problems"/>
			<xsd:enumeration value="NCTM:Problem Solving:Monitor and reflect on the process of mathematical problem solving"/>
			<xsd:enumeration value="NCTM:Reasoning and Proof:Recognize reasoning and proof as fundamental aspects of mathematics"/>
			<xsd:enumeration value="NCTM:Reasoning and Proof:Make and investigate mathematical conjectures"/>
			<xsd:enumeration value="NCTM:Reasoning and Proof:Develop and evaluate mathematical arguments and proofs"/>
			<xsd:enumeration value="NCTM:Reasoning and Proof:Select and use various types of reasoning and methods of proof"/>
			<xsd:enumeration value="NCTM:Communication:Organize and consolidate their mathematical thinking through communication"/>
			<xsd:enumeration value="NCTM:Communication:Communicate their mathematical thinking coherently and clearly to peers, teachers, and others"/>
			<xsd:enumeration value="NCTM:Communication:Analyze and evaluate the mathematical thinking and strategies of others"/>
			<xsd:enumeration value="NCTM:Communication:Use the language of mathematics to express mathematical ideas precisely"/>
			<xsd:enumeration value="NCTM:Connections:Recognize and use connections among mathematical ideas"/>
			<xsd:enumeration value="NCTM:Connections:Understand how mathematical ideas interconnect and build on one another to produce a coherent whole"/>
			<xsd:enumeration value="NCTM:Connections:Recognize and apply mathematics in contexts outside of mathematics"/>
			<xsd:enumeration value="NCTM:Representation:Create and use representations to organize, record, and communicate mathematical ideas"/>
			<xsd:enumeration value="NCTM:Representation:Select, apply, and translate among mathematical representations to solve problems"/>
			<xsd:enumeration value="NCTM:Representation:Use representations to model and interpret physical, social, and mathematical phenomena"/>
		</xsd:restriction>
	</xsd:simpleType>
